career roles key responsibilities
wind energy analyst data collection, wind resource assessment, energy yield analysis
wind farm designer layout optimization, turbine placement, feasibility studies
renewable energy consultant client advisory, project planning, regulatory compliance
wind energy modeler simulation modeling, performance analysis, software utilization
project manager (wind energy) team coordination, budget management, timeline oversight
research scientist (wind energy) innovation, data analysis, publication of findings
energy policy advisor policy development, stakeholder engagement, sustainability advocacy
